The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Richard Dixon, born in 1814 in Burton, Westmorland, consisted of 7 members. Richard was the head of the household, married to Jane Dixon, born in 1817 in Lancashire, England. They had 3 children; Richard (born 1855 in Borwick, Lancashire, England), Samuel (born 1858 in Priest Hutton, Lancashire, England) and William T (born 1862 in Priest Hutton, Lancashire, England). They had 2 grandchildren; Fred (born 1864 in Priest Hutton, Lancashire, England) and Jane (born 1871 in Priest Hutton, Lancashire, England).
